Java Integer.signum() – Examples

In this tutorial, we will learn about Java Integer.signum() method, and learn how to use this method to find the value of signum function for a given integer, with the help of examples.

signum(int i)

Integer.signum(i) returns the signum function of the specified int value i.

Syntax

The syntax of signum() method with integer value as parameter is

Integer.signum(int i)

where

ParameterDescription
iThe integer value whose signum has to be found.

Returns

The method returns value of type int.

Example 1 – signum(i) – i is Positive

In this example, we will take a positive integer and find the signum function of this integer using Integer.signum() method. Since we passed a positive integer as argument, signum() returns 1.

Java Program

public class Example {
	public static void main(String[] args){
		int i = 4;
		int result = Integer.signum(i);
		System.out.println("Result of signum("+i+") = " + result);
	}
}

Output

Result of signum(4) = 1

Example 2 – signum(i) – i is Zero

In this example, we will find the signum function of zero using Integer.signum() method. signum() should return zero for returns for input zero.

Java Program

public class Example {
	public static void main(String[] args){
		int i = 0;
		int result = Integer.signum(i);
		System.out.println("Result of signum("+i+") = " + result);
	}
}

Output

Result of signum(0) = 0

Example 3 – signum(i) – i is Negative

In this example, we will take a negative integer and find the signum function of this integer using Integer.signum() method. Since we passed a negative integer as argument, signum() returns -1.

Java Program

public class Example {
	public static void main(String[] args){
		int i = -5;
		int result = Integer.signum(i);
		System.out.println("Result of signum("+i+") = " + result);
	}
}

Output

Result of signum(-5) = -1
